We’re looking for backend engineers who have experience building and operating reliable, scalable systems. Your background may be in product engineering, infrastructure, platform engineering, or a combination of these. What matters most is strong backend fundamentals, sound systems thinking, and the ability to take ownership of complex technical problems from design through production. Below you can find more information about the team we're hiring for: Ads: Duolingo's Monetization pillar builds the systems that fund our mission — from subscription packaging and advertising to ML-powered personalization. As a Backend Engineer on the Ads team, you'll work on a product engineering team responsible for growing and scaling Duolingo's ads business: high-quality ads that delight learners, fit seamlessly into the product experience, and meaningfully contribute to our bottom line. The team owns ad serving, mediation and demand, in-product ad formats and surfaces, and more. You'll work cross-functionally with product, design, data science, machine learning, and ad operations.
